- [ ] **Step 7: Breaker override escrow.** After sealing the signing keys for the Tallgrove upstream API circuit breaker, confirm the support team can force the breaker open during a full outage. The override bundle lives in the sealed escrow drawer and is useless without its unlock phrase. Two ceremony witnesses must initial this step before proceeding. The escrow bundle is decrypted with the recovery passphrase that follows.

vault phrase of kahip-kahop = holath-quenmir

- [ ] Step 7: Archive cold storage buckets (Glacierline tier). Confirm both ceremony witnesses are present, verify bucket manifests match the Oxbow ledger, then seal the archive key shares. Plugin authors may observe but not handle shares. Once sealed, the archive index itself is encrypted and can only be reopened with the passphrase below.

vault phrase of badup-hahig = tamael-aldael-kelmir-istael-fenok-istwyn-tamius-jorath-oliion

Subject: Cut-over complete — export retry pipeline

Hi Soren,

The cut-over to the new retry pipeline for Verdane exports finished last night. Failed exports now land in a dedicated retry queue with exponential backoff instead of the old cron sweep. We replayed the 312 stuck jobs from last week; all cleared within an hour. No data loss observed. Please review the retry handler diff with the backoff math in mind. For reference, the service now runs with these values.

config for haweg-bagag:
[kasath]
host = kasath.qirvancorp.internal
user = kasath_svc
database = kasath_prod

Release checklist — Wayfinder autocomplete widget. Heads up for whoever cuts this next: the widget caches locality data aggressively, so after bumping the dataset version you need to flush the edge cache or users in smaller towns will see stale suggestions for up to a day. Yes, we learned this the hard way. Once the flush completes and smoke tests pass, record the shipped widget build, which appears below.

trace token, fafog-kageg: htk4_98e6